Heights at Westridge, Frisco,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Heights at Westridge?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Heights at Westridge 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,282 | $1,450 | $2,795 |
| Heights at Westridge 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,586 | $1,650 | $6,500 |
| Heights at Westridge 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,379 | $2,300 | $7,000 |
Heights at Westridge 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,254 | $2,700 | $10,000+ |
| Heights at Westridge 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,739 | $3,350 | $7,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Heights at Westridge
What type of rentals are currently available in Heights at Westridge?
There are currently 53 Apartments for Rent in Heights at Westridge, TX with pricing that ranges from $975 to $16,876. There are also 298 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Heights at Westridge ranging from $1,450 to $12,900.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Heights at Westridge?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Heights at Westridge ranges from $1,450 to $12,900 with an average monthly rent of $3,448.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Heights at Westridge?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Heights at Westridge range from $1,444 to $7,144,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,650 to $6,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,300 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$3,595.
